Several City departments heading to Matroosfontein to avail services

09 May 2025

The City of Cape Town's Corporate Services Directorate is bringing its basket of services offering to the Matroosfontein Civic Centre on Wednesday, 14 May 2025. Several City departments will be in attendance to present their services and will assist residents with enquiries or concerns that affect them. Read more below:

The details of the event are as follows:

Wednesday, 14 May 2025, from 09:00 to 15:00 at the Matroosfontein Civic Centre, Civic Way, Matroosfontein.
 'Taking the City's services to the community of Matroosfontein is the City's way of showing that we are actually committed to bringing services to residents and making local government more accessible to all. Those who will be visiting us at the Civic Centre on Wednesday must please remember to bring along their ID or municipal accounts to help ease the process,' said the City's Mayoral Committee Member for Corporate Services, Alderman Theresa Uys.

 The departments that will be present at the Lavender Hill Community Centre are:

  • Human Resources: For enquiries about bursaries, internships and Apprenticeships
  • Social Development: To find out how you can get involved
  • Energy
  • Health: For more about primary health care services
  • Safety and Security: For information about traffic and law enforcement services
  • EPWP: Will assist jobseekers and unemployed youth with opportunities to register on the jobseekers database so that they are eligible for job opportunities that become available in their local communities
  • Customer Relations Mobile Unit
  • Customers can engage with the City in a wide range of non-emergency enquiries such as rates, sewage, electricity, water, refuse collections, and all other account enquiries.
